Description A U.S. Navy Martin P5M-2 Marlin (BuNo 135534) from Patrol Squadron VP-47 being hoisted aboard the seaplane tender USS Currituck (AV-7). VP-31 was deployed to Kodiak, Alaska (USA) from 27 May to 30 September 1962.
